stepbystep approach 1 Mastering the Fundamentals Begin by thoroughly reviewing the fundamental concepts 2 covered in your textbook Engineering Economy 1st Edition Focus on understanding the underlying principles of the time value of money Familiarize yourself with terms like Present Worth PW The current value of future cash flows Future Worth FW The value of an investment at a future date Annual Worth AW The equivalent uniform annual cost or benefit of an investment over its lifetime Internal Rate of Return IRR The discount rate that makes the net present worth of an investment equal to zero BenefitCost Ratio BCR The ratio of the present worth of benefits to the present worth of costs Depreciation Methods Straightline declining balance MACRS Modified Accelerated Cost Recovery System understanding the implications of each method on tax calculations and project profitability 2 Utilizing Engineering Economy 1st Edition Solutions Effectively While solutions manuals provide answers equip you to make informed economic decisions throughout your engineering career Frequently Asked Questions FAQs 1 What is the best way to approach complex engineering economy problems Break down complex problems into smaller manageable parts Identify the key variables cash flows and relevant economic factors Draw a cash flow diagram to visualize the problem Then apply the appropriate analysis techniques systematically 2 How important is understanding different depreciation methods Depreciation methods significantly impact tax calculations and the overall profitability of a project Understanding their implications is essential for accurate economic analysis and informed decisionmaking particularly in longterm projects 3 Where can I find additional practice problems beyond my
